Abstract

Fabrication of metal matrix composites via casting methods is under attention due to poor wettability of reinforcement particles within the metallic matrix. In order to improve wettability of reinforcement particles in different metallic matrix, surface of reinforcement can be modified with different metallic coating agents. Nickel and copper are favor coating agent, and can be deposited on the surface of particles by electroless deposition (ED) method. However, in electroless deposition it is difficult to obtain uniform and nano-sized metallic coating on the nanoparticles. In this study, copper coating Al2O3 micro and nano particles by ED studied. In order to reach to the maximum efficiency of electroless deposition, the effect of ED parameters, such as concentration of Al2O3 particles, bath temperature, plating time, stirring speed and Al2O3 particle size, optimized by Taguchi method. Through optimization the process, maximum plating rate and optimum properties of coated layers (uniformity, optimum composition and minimum thickness) considered as desired outcomes. The morphology, uniformity, and chemical composition of the activated and Cu coated Al2O3 particles were characterized by scanning electron microscopy (SEM), transmission electron microscopy (TEM), energy dispersive spectroscopy (EDS) and X-ray diffraction (XRD). The results show that, Bath temperature with 61.35% contribution; plating time with 23.7% contribution and Al2O3 concentration with 12.81% contribution have the most influences on the process plating rate, respectively.
